Publisher's summary

Sabine Debois likes her wine pink and her life predictable. As a private tutor for the rich and famous, she doesn’t get starstruck. But when a tattooed espresso fiend saves her from death by sweater, she’s a little bit…grateful. That’s all. Just grateful.

Sunshine Capone just had the best album of his career, and then his girlfriend burned down his house. Well, his ex-girlfriend now. So he moved to Chicago to focus on his music and avoid the drama of relationships.

He should not be creating any excuses to hang out with the sweet teacher with the hazel eyes and bright smile. She doesn’t need his kind of confusion in her life.

But Sabine’s about to teach this superstar a thing or two about peace, love, and understanding.

Sunshine & Dark Helmet!

This opposites-attract, slow-burn, rockstar romance is one of my favorite books this year! The bad boy rapper meets the adorkable good girl teacher. The instant chemistry between Sabine and Sunshine made my heart ache in the best way. If you’re looking for a fun, witty, heartwarming rockstar romance, then Sabine and Sunshine will steal your heart.

Samantha Brentmoor and Liam DiCosimo were perfectly paired for this dual narration! Their styles and pacing compliment each other well; the audiobook flows beautifully throughout. Samantha’s performance of Sabine’s delightful, whip-smart, sweet character is fabulous. Her voice for Sunshine Capone was perfect! Liam DiCosimo catapulted Sunshine’s reserved, goofy, loveable, and charming personality off the page. Lost Track is a relatable, heart-melting, swoony, low-steam romance. DNF: Lighthearted romance but not for me

The funniest part of the story was in the sample audible. The fact that the main male character had a disability was refreshing, but I often felt it was told explicitly and repeated multiple times. It was shown through his actions and thoughts too (which was great) but it just felt like it was being overdone. There were sweet moments between the leads but I often wondered if that was how adults, in that type of situation, would have acted. The plotline was interesting, but I often had to push myself to listen to the story so DNF.
